Meaning of grated

Source language: EnglishDictionary language: English

grated

Pronunciation:[ˈɡɹeɪ̯ɾɪd]

verb

Definitions

  1. To furnish with grates; to protect with a grating or crossbars

    Example: to grate a window

verb

Definitions

  1. To shred (things, usually foodstuffs), by rubbing across a grater

    Example: I need to grate the cheese before the potato is cooked.

  2. To make an unpleasant rasping sound, often as the result of rubbing against something

    Example: Listening to his teeth grate all day long drives me mad.

  3. (by extension) to get on one's nerves; to irritate, annoy

    Example: She’s nice enough, but she can begin to grate if there is no-one else to talk to.

  4. (by extension) to annoy

adjective

Definitions

  1. Produced by grating.

    Example: I topped my chili with grated cheese and my mango soufflé with grated orange rind.

  2. Furnished with a grate or grating.

    Example: grated windows
